Abstract

The utility model relates to a waste heat device for boiler smoke. The device comprises a waste heat boiler which comprises a boiler body, a smoke chamber connected to the bottom of the boiler body and a steam pipeline connected to the top of the boiler body, wherein the smoke chamber is provided with a smoke inlet and a smoke outlet and is connected with the smoke outlet through a flue. The device further comprises a water containing device tightly attached to the outer wall of the flue, a first water pump, a hot water recovery tank and a second water pump. The water containing device is connected with a soft water conveying pipeline, and is further connected with the hot water recovery tank through the first water pump. The hot water recovery tank is connected with the boiler body through the second water pump. The device provided by the utility model secondarily recovers high temperature smoke to utilize the high temperature smoke to the maximum extent.

Background technology
The Industrial Boiler such as steam boiler, heat conducting oil boiler, use the resources such as coal in a large number, and a large amount of high-temperature flue gas that Industrial Boiler produces every day directly enter atmosphere after the economizer simple process, to enterprise, cause huge waste.Can collect the heat of the high-temperature flue gas of boiler discharge,, by heat exchange, make heat recovery wherein, again produce the mode of steam, more and more obtain the welcome of enterprise.
Traditional waste heat boiler, only reclaim once fume afterheat, fails the maximum using high temperature flue-gas from boiler.

The specific embodiment
Below, by reference to the accompanying drawings and the specific embodiment, the utility model is described further:
As shown in Figure 1, a kind of residual heat from boiler fume device, it comprises waste heat boiler, water storage unit 8, the first water pump 12, Recovery of the hot water case 11 and the second water pump 13.
Described waste heat boiler comprises body of heater 6, the smoke chamber 14 that is connected with body of heater 6 bottoms and the jet chimney 3 that is connected with body of heater 6 tops, and described smoke chamber 14 has gas approach 1 and exhanst gas outlet 15.Smoke chamber 14 is connected with exhanst gas outlet 15 by flue 7.
Water storage unit 8 is close to flue 7 outer walls, so that the high-temperature flue gas in the soft water in water storage unit 8 and flue 7 carries out heat exchange.Water storage unit 8 is connected with a soft water conveyance conduit 9, and water storage unit 8 also is connected with Recovery of the hot water case 11 by pipeline 10, the first water pump 12, and Recovery of the hot water case 11 is connected with body of heater 6 by the second water pump 13, pipeline 5.
Body of heater 6 has safety valve 4, on safety valve 4, Pressure gauge is installed.Flowmeter 2 is installed on jet chimney 3.The bottom of body of heater 6 is provided with sewage draining exit 16.
The course of work of the present embodiment is as follows:
High-temperature flue gas enters smoke chamber 14 from gas approach 1, high-temperature flue gas and body of heater 6 in smoke chamber 14 carry out heat exchange for the first time, high-temperature flue gas continues to enter flue 7 and with the soft water in water storage unit 8, carries out heat exchange for the second time, soft water in water storage unit 8 becomes hot water, and be extracted into Recovery of the hot water case 11 by the first water pump 12 and store, the second water pump 13 is extracted into the hot water in Recovery of the hot water case 11 in body of heater 6, after body of heater 6 continues to carry out heat exchange with high-temperature flue gas, the interior generation steam of body of heater 6, steam is by jet chimney 3 and use hot equipment connection.
Flowmeter 2 can carry out Real-Time Monitoring to steam flow.Pressure gauge can carry out Real-Time Monitoring to steam pressure.
The present embodiment has following features:
1, easy for installation, need not traditional waste heat boiler is changed.
2, jet chimney is installed flowmeter, accurate and visual measurement steam flow.
3, by high-temperature flue gas is carried out secondary recovery, the high-temperature flue gas of maximum using boiler, reach effects of energy saving and emission reduction.
